North Carolina's climate, with its humid summers and mild, wet winters, provides ample opportunity for mold growth. Coastal areas experience high humidity year-round, while inland regions can suffer from moisture intrusion after heavy rains or during temperature fluctuations. This makes consistent mold remediation essential across the state, from Charlotte's urban environments to Durham's residential areas.
North Carolina does not require a specific state license for mold remediation. However, it is crucial to select a provider with verifiable certifications and insurance.
